Poker is a card game that involves betting and an element of chance, but with enough skill and psychology to make the game incredibly interesting. It is played in private homes and in countless casinos around the world. The game is fast-paced and the players bet continuously until one person has all the chips or everyone folds. During a hand, the player with the best 5-card poker hand wins the “pot” – all of the money that is bet during that hand. This may happen after a single betting street, or after multiple betting streets if no one calls a raise. If there is a tie, the pot is split amongst all of the players who have a high poker hand.

When a Poker game is being played, the players usually establish a special fund called the kitty. This kitty is made up of low-denomination chips that are contributed by each player every time there is more than one raise in a hand. This kitty is used to pay for new decks of cards and food and drinks at the table. In addition, any unused chips that remain in the kitty when a Poker game ends are taken by the players who were still playing at the end of the hand.
